Astronauts Repair Comms Unit For SpaceX Flight

HOUSTON — International Space Station astronauts Don Pettit of NASA and Andre Kuipers of the European Space Agency have replaced a UHF communications unit aboard the station that will be required for the upcoming berthing of the unpiloted SpaceX Dragon cargo capsule.
